Output 905858dc81e2815f9b017545cab5bdb520b25db7aa63d6ffef36826b56d7ceec:1

value
7999891509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9da6a9453b25f591fc160e156d006b67c8c56f8 OP_EQUAL
address
3MYvD19RcUGuAwYAhf1ufqo3vkCkK1XHbK
transaction
905858dc81e2815f9b017545cab5bdb520b25db7aa63d6ffef36826b56d7ceec
spent
true